QueryContext QueryContext QueryContext QueryContext Class

Определение

Представляет список параметров, используемых для выполнения запроса к источнику данных.Represents a list of parameters that are used to query a data source.

public ref class QueryContext
public class QueryContext
type QueryContext = class
Public Class QueryContext
Наследование
QueryContextQueryContextQueryContextQueryContext

Конструкторы

QueryContext(IDictionary<String,Object>, IDictionary<String,Object>, IOrderedDictionary, IDictionary<String,Object>, IDictionary<String,Object>, DataSourceSelectArguments) QueryContext(IDictionary<String,Object>, IDictionary<String,Object>, IOrderedDictionary, IDictionary<String,Object>, IDictionary<String,Object>, DataSourceSelectArguments) QueryContext(IDictionary<String,Object>, IDictionary<String,Object>, IOrderedDictionary, IDictionary<String,Object>, IDictionary<String,Object>, DataSourceSelectArguments) QueryContext(IDictionary<String,Object>, IDictionary<String,Object>, IOrderedDictionary, IDictionary<String,Object>, IDictionary<String,Object>, DataSourceSelectArguments)

Инициализирует новый экземпляр класса QueryContext, используя свойства WhereParameters, OrderGroupsByParameters, OrderByParameters, GroupByParameters, SelectParameters и Arguments.Initializes new instance of the QueryContext class by using the WhereParameters, OrderGroupsByParameters, OrderByParameters, GroupByParameters, SelectParameters, and Arguments properties.

Свойства

Arguments Arguments Arguments Arguments

Получает или задает аргументы для передачи классу QueryContext.Gets or sets the arguments to pass to the QueryContext class.

GroupByParameters GroupByParameters GroupByParameters GroupByParameters

Получает или задает коллекцию параметров, определяющих, какие свойства используются для группировки извлеченных данных.Gets or sets a collection of parameters that specify which properties are used to group the retrieved data.

OrderByParameters OrderByParameters OrderByParameters OrderByParameters

Получает или задает коллекцию параметров, определяющих, какие поля используются для упорядочивания извлеченных данных.Gets or sets a collection of parameters that specify which fields are used to order the retrieved data.

OrderGroupsByParameters OrderGroupsByParameters OrderGroupsByParameters OrderGroupsByParameters

Получает или задает коллекцию параметров, определяющих, какие поля используются для упорядочивания сгруппированных данных.Gets or set a collection of parameters that specify fields that are used to order grouped data.

SelectParameters SelectParameters SelectParameters SelectParameters

Получает или задает коллекцию параметров, определяющих, какие свойства и вычисляемые значения включаются в извлеченные данные.Gets or sets a collection of parameters that specify the properties and calculated values that are included in the retrieved data.

WhereParameters WhereParameters WhereParameters WhereParameters

Получает или задает коллекцию параметров, задающих условия, которые должны соблюдаться для записи, чтобы она была включена в извлекаемые данные.Gets or sets a collection of parameters that specify the conditions that must be true for a record to be included in the retrieved data.

Методы

Equals(Object) Equals(Object) Equals(Object) Equals(Object)

Определяет, равен ли заданный объект текущему объекту.Determines whether the specified object is equal to the current object.

(Inherited from Object)
GetHashCode() GetHashCode() GetHashCode() GetHashCode()

Служит хэш-функцией по умолчанию.Serves as the default hash function.

(Inherited from Object)
GetType() GetType() GetType() GetType()

Возвращает объект Type для текущего экземпляра.Gets the Type of the current instance.

(Inherited from Object)
MemberwiseClone() MemberwiseClone() MemberwiseClone() MemberwiseClone()

Создает неполную копию текущего объекта Object.Creates a shallow copy of the current Object.

(Inherited from Object)
ToString() ToString() ToString() ToString()

Возвращает строку, представляющую текущий объект.Returns a string that represents the current object.

(Inherited from Object)

Применяется к